Mr. Big have announced their 10th studio album, simply titled Ten, which arrives July 12th.
The hard rock vets also offered up lead single “Good Luck Trying.” The song is built around a strutting blues riff from guitarist Paul Gilbert and unfurls at a fast pace. If the verses carry a heavy Led Zeppelin vibe, then the slowed-down chorus is more Bad Company, opening up space for frontman Eric Martin’s strong vocal delivery.

“Overall, it’s about being overwhelmed with life, and realizing that you won’t win many of the battles, but still fighting to the end,” stated Gilbert on the lyrics. “And keeping a sense of humor about it by saying to anyone nearby, ‘Wish me good luck trying!'”

Mr. Big have announced the next two legs of their farewell tour. “The Big Finish” world tour will hit the States in the winter of 2024, followed by a spring UK/European run.
The veteran rock act recently wrapped up the first leg in Japan and Southeast Asia. The US outing will kick off January 12th in Houston and run through a February 24th gig in Oklahoma City. Mr. Big have announced a farewell tour, taking place in 2023 and 2024. As of now the veteran rock band has unveiled dates for a run of Asia this summer, with US, European, and South American shows slated to be revealed for 2024.
The tour, dubbed “The Big Finish,” will find Mr. Big playing its 1991 album Lean Into It in its entirety. The LP yielded the band’s smash ballad “To Be With You,” which hit No. 1 on the Billboard Hot 100 chart.
In a press release, Mr. Big said that it’s the right to time to end their touring career following the passing of drummer Pat Torpey, who died in 2018 after a battle with Parkinson’s disease. The band also revealed that Nick D’Virgilio will fill Torpey’s slot behind the drum kit.
“We wanted to do a proper farewell, and this seems like the right way to do it,” stated bassist Billy Sheehan.
